What type Prep work did you completed last time for your unmedicated birth ?

A few things you might want to try this time around

-Pelvic floor therapy - they’ll teach you how to breath / push & protect your pelvic floor -a good solid child birth education class ( find someone who does “evidenced based birth “) this will help you prepare on medical interventions/ options etc . - hire a doula if no one in your area consider a a virtual doula - HOSPITAL policy is not the law and NO / I don’t consent are enough.

( I’m a birth doula and strictly support hospital births / also please educate yourself on the difference between physiological birth / unmedicated ) An epidural is a great tool ! If you were to need or want one again there’s lots of things you can do to still have a beautiful experience :)

Push on your side , on 4s anything but your back ( still very possible with the right support ) , wait for baby to be at a lower station before pushing . Not just 10cm. Again a solid CBE class and a doula will be your best choice ☺️
